Hi Roger,
The Subject should use below prefix:
ARM: dts: rockchip: add gmac info for rk3288
On 11/25/2014 05:08 PM, Roger Chen wrote:
> add gmac info in rk3288.dtsi for GMAC driver
>
> Signed-off-by: Roger Chen <roger.chen@rock-chips.com>
> ---
> arch/arm/boot/dts/rk3288.dtsi | 59 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
> 1 file changed, 59 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/rk3288.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/rk3288.dtsi
> index 0f50d5d..949675d 100644
> ---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/rk3288.dtsi
> +++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/rk3288.dtsi
> @@ -137,6 +137,13 @@
> #clock-cells = <0>;
> };
>
> + ext_gmac: external-gmac-clock {
> + compatible = "fixed-clock";
> + clock-frequency = <125000000>;
> + clock-output-names = "ext_gmac";
> + #clock-cells = <0>;
> + };
> +
I'm not sure Heiko will happy with both add the new clock source and
gmac node in these patch.
> timer {
> compatible = "arm,armv7-timer";
> interrupts = <GIC_PPI 13 (GIC_CPU_MASK_SIMPLE(4) | I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H)>,
> @@ -490,6 +497,25 @@
> reg = <0xff740000 0x1000>;
> };
>
> + gmac: eth@ff290000 {
> + compatible = "rockchip,rk3288-gmac";
> + reg = <0xff290000 0x10000>;
> + interrupts = <GIC_SPI 27 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>; /*irq=59*/
> + interrupt-names = "macirq";
> + rockchip,grf = <&grf>;
> + clocks = <&cru SCLK_MAC>, <&cru SCLK_MAC_PLL>,
> + <&cru SCLK_MAC_RX>, <&cru SCLK_MAC_TX>,
> + <&cru SCLK_MACREF>, <&cru SCLK_MACREF_OUT>,
> + <&cru ACLK_GMAC>, <&cru PCLK_GMAC>;
> + clock-names = "stmmaceth", "clk_mac_pll",
> + "mac_clk_rx", "mac_clk_tx",
> + "clk_mac_ref", "clk_mac_refout",
> + "aclk_mac", "pclk_mac";
> + phy-mode = "rgmii";
> + pinctrl-names = "default";
> + pinctrl-0 = <&rgmii_pin /*&rmii_pin*/>;
> + };
> +
The controller dts node should be sort by the base address, I'm sure
this is in a
wrong place.
- Kever
